Output ffbb526bd56ad583785abf5000f23e40662ac9ea350d60766eed84d240d1f5a3:1

value
380989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64bd752f852f0458c4e4348dd00025d233001044 OP_EQUALVERIFY OP_CHECKSIG
address
1ABfXwStNX7r1GuqjfbY6aHhC47hPa44Hk
transaction
ffbb526bd56ad583785abf5000f23e40662ac9ea350d60766eed84d240d1f5a3
spent
true